Progress and Planned Activities
• Pavement Operations are beginning in the Northeast Quadrant
• McCarthy will maintain driveways by adding crushed stone as required
• Relocated Street Lighting during construction to be maintained and illuminate along new
roadway
• METRO/McCarthy are working to adjust schedule activities to keep the project on schedule
• Select construction activities will be built concurrently with major bridge activities during the third phase of
construction
• McCarthy will be working extended hours to expedite completion of roadway pavement
• The placing, finishing, curing, and saw cutting new pavement requires extended work hours
• Utility crews started 12 hour days instead of 10 hours
• To make up time due to rain, McCarthy chose to work on one Sunday in November
• McCarthy plans to work extra shifts during the drilling of the 6 major bridge bents in Phase II
of the project
• Weather permitting, this work will begin in January 2016

30 Day Look Ahead
West of UPRR






Complete 24” Storm east of Caylor
Water line and Sanitary Sewer Service Taps
Rough grade, lime stabilize subgrade, fine grade, erect forms, place steel reinforcement, place
concrete, cure, and saw cut for new roadway, intersection and driveway pavement
Install curbs and sidewalks
Install underground conduit for bridge lighting
Install temporary asphalt transitions from existing roadway to new concrete pavement
East of UPRR






Complete all storm sewer lines
Complete 8” waterlines
Complete Sanitary sewer lines
Wet connects for water services
Clear and grub right of way for new roadway pavement
Rough grade, lime stabilize subgrade, fine grade, erect forms, place steel reinforcement, place
concrete, cure, and saw cut for new roadway, intersection and driveway pavement

Traffic control switch from south to north side of Harrisburg to complete utility work in southeast
quadrant
